On Wednesday I went to my girlfriends and left me cat in the flat, she was fine jumping around and bitching at me as normal, basically being an irritating little fook, called home on Friday night to see how she is and replenish her food supplies etc and she didnt seem herself.

Anyway, I picked her up to give her a hug and she went really mad at me, hissing, yelping the works!! So I got really worried, couldnt understand it, so I put her on the floor and noticed her back legs gave way, she couldnt walk.

I thought I would give it a day or and see how she is, anyway she seemed to get really bad and upset on the Saturday night, to the point where I was on the verge of calling out an Emergency vet.

Anyway, yesterday, after a good 10 hours sleep, she seemed much better, although still nowhere near right. Again today, she seems to have improved a bit, but I took her the vet anyway.

The vet has said she has either slipped a disc, which should fix itself in time, or she has a tuma on her spine. Given the fact she seems to be getting better since Saturday, the vet was quite positive, so I just got my fingers crossed now.

She gave her an injection into her spinal area and a course of pills, got to go back in a week or so if she is no better for further investiagation.

I hope she's alright, she is only 11 this year and I know that's not too old for a cat; she must be really unwell, cos she has never been ill before in her life, or at least she has never let on about it.

Will keep peeps updated.
